GEOM Structure Studio
GEOM Structure Studio is a native desktop GUI for interactive nanoparticle and graphene creation, 3D visualization, and structure manipulation.
Launching the App
From the terminal — load the environment with geom_load, then run:
geomapp
macOS — the installer creates a native .app bundle at ~/Applications/GEOM.app.
Open it directly from Finder or Spotlight.
Linux / WSL — the installer registers a .desktop entry at
~/.local/share/applications/geom.desktop. Open GEOM from your application launcher.
Generator
Create nanoparticles and graphene structures with interactive parameter controls.
Supported nanoparticle shapes:
Sphere, Rod, Tip, Pyramid, Cone, Microscope
Icosahedron, Cuboctahedron, Decahedron
Supported graphene shapes:
Disk, Ribbon, Ring, Triangle
Optional configurations: alloy, dimer, bowtie, core-shell.
Viewer
Load structures via the file picker or drag-and-drop (XYZ, PDB, SMILES). Multiple structures open in separate tabs.
Controls:
Sphere size, bond width, and resolution sliders.
Atom selection — VMD-like coordinate expressions, e.g.
x > 0 and name C.Rotate — drag. Pan — Shift+drag. Zoom — scroll.
Reset view —
Shift+0.
Manipulator
Operate on any loaded structure using the source selector.
Translate — move along any axis by a given distance.
Rotate — rotate around any axis by a given angle.
Mirror — generate the enantiomer (mirror + center).
Center — translate center of mass to the origin.
Pair / Controlled distance — place two structures at a precise surface-to-surface distance along any axis.
